One of the primary roles of an arborist is diagnosing and addressing tree diseases. Trees, like all living organisms, are susceptible to infections, pests, and environmental stress. Arborists use their expertise to identify signs of disease, such as discolored leaves, fungal growth, or unusual branch dieback. Once diagnosed, they implement treatment plans that may include pruning, applying targeted pesticides, or improving soil conditions. Also, arborists help prevent diseases by promoting proper tree care practices. This includes fertilization, mulching, and watering techniques tailored to specific tree species and local climates. They can also recommend planting strategies that reduce stress on trees, such as selecting species suited to the area and ensuring adequate spacing.
Pruning is a critical aspect of an arborist's work. Proper pruning enhances tree health by removing dead, damaged, or diseased branches, which can otherwise hinder growth or create entry points for pests. Pruning also shapes trees for aesthetic appeal and structural integrity, ensuring that they grow in a balanced manner. Arborists also assess trees for weak or overgrown branches that could pose risks during storms. By mitigating these hazards, they help protect people and property. For homeowners and businesses, this service is invaluable in preventing costly damage caused by falling limbs.
Arborists are often called upon to evaluate trees for safety concerns. Trees with compromised structural integrity due to disease, decay, or storm damage can become liabilities. Arborists use advanced techniques, such as climbing inspections, to assess the extent of damage. As necessary, arborists can safely remove hazardous trees.
